Ticket: Vault locked out — digest scheduler config stuck

Hey, the Pigeonpost vault auto-locked after three bad attempts while I was updating the batch email digest schedule, so the 06:00 and noon digest jobs are now running with last week's recipient rules. Release is tomorrow, so we need this unwedged tonight. Ops already reset the attempt counter on their end; you just need to reopen the vault and re-save the cron block. Unlock it using the passphrase below.

vault phrase of taweg-kafof = oliax-zorael

**Break-Glass Access: Tidepool Widget**

So the tide-table widget on Shorely went sideways and normal access is dead — here's the break-glass path. This bypasses the Harborline SSO entirely, so only use it when the widget is actively wrong-footing customers about tide times. File an incident first, ping whoever's on call, and keep notes. Once that's done, log into the break-glass console using the recovery passphrase given directly below:

unlock words, hahip-baduf: holwyn-istath-julvan

Leadership Review Briefing — Kestrel Foods Franchise Deal

Heads-up for sales leads: we're close to signing the franchise agreement with the Dunmarsh group covering the eastern corridor. They take three sites in year one, with options on five more. Royalty structure is standard; training obligations sit with us through spring. Expect territory questions from your teams — hold answers until signing. Background on the plan follows below.

board note of yadup-fajef: Druiusox Holdings is in early talks to buy Norwynek Systems for about $186.0 million. The Kaseth launch date is June 24, and nothing goes to the press before then. Legal wants the Quenethek Group term sheet withdrawn before November 27.

Action item from the Periwick timetable solver outage (term-start rollover). The solver looped when room constraints conflicted with split lunches; the backtracking cap was never tuned for schools above 900 students. Fix: enforce a hard iteration budget and degrade to partial schedules with warnings instead of hanging. Maintainers: do not raise the budget without rerunning the Harlow Academy benchmark suite. The constants below were validated against that suite and should be treated as the baseline.

constants for kageg-bawif:
QUOTAS = {
    "quenwyn": 1,
    "oliix": 10,
}